You need to get away from all bullet (small) mufflers to kill your loud tone. The larger the muffler the more sound that is taken away. I doubt the spirals will make any difference except change the way it sounds. It won't quiet it down unless you install a larger muffler. High flow cats are another way to take the tone down some. My true duals with have twin 93506 car sound cats to kill rasp and fuel smell.

The 18" Twisters are the quietest I've used. Still nasty when you're on the gas, but fairly mellow at cruising speeds.

Straight bullets are just obnoxious... Which is great for some people, but usually gets old fast.
